Fun in the Black Hills sun!
Clockwise loop through the desert 1st half, finished on the old Duncan-Safford Highway 2nd half.
Such a cool scenic area, looks like an old spaghetti western movie scene.
Cold at the start, warm at the finish.
Wildflowers are coming in good, a few patches of poppies and several water tanks with cattle.
We finished a bit early so decided to make it a daily double with a trip out to Hot Well Dunes.

We drove the 25 miles out on Haekel Road which is always an adventure on that road.
Made it to the dunes with about an hour to spend.
Made a quick hike up to an overlook in the sand followed by a visit to the hot tubs (2) where we visited with some friendly folks before leaving.
Headed back home to Safford via Tanque Road which is also an adventurous road.
Lot's of poppies seen on this road out.

We had a fun full day!

Another great trip out to the good ol' Black Hills to hike the loop trail I discovered a few months ago south of Hwy 191. This whole area to me looks like the backdrop of an old western movie and I just love it! Hiked the loop clockwise and was treated to great sloping desert views with a butte/pinnacle around every bend. Along the way were many stock tanks, cattle, corrals and even the remains of an old Ford model T (I think) beside the old Hwy 70 road. The only thing missing on this trip were the rattlesnakes, gila monsters & tarantulas which I'm sure will be out soon. There were also many nice patches of poppies throughout to keep my camera finger busy! A huge trophy white-tail buck was the big wildlife sighting of the day right at the end of the hike as the sun was setting.

I have always been fascinated with the Black Hills while driving through them on my travels to Morenci & Duncan. There are no real hiking trails in the hills so I had to make my own using Google Earth. I discovered that by combining the Old West Hwy 70 (closed for 40+ years) and a jeep trail, it would make for a nice loop in the heart of the Southwestern portion of the Black Hills. This one turned out to be an absolute home run! Both the jeep trail & the old Hwy were in great shape, the old Hwy still has most of it's surface left, and the loop's scenery of the hills and beyond just blew me away! There will be many, many more hikes for me along (and off) this trail in the near future. Definitely one of my top 5 hikes of the Year!

The only bummer of this hike was the very overcast skies, I took a little over 300 pics and none really captured the awesome scenery I saw. :(
